OH and we saw the BOCA JUNIORS play at the Bombenaria (sweet box). Boca are that cheating midget but lets face it awesome football legend Maradonnas old team. The atmosphere (due to the 12th jugador - the fans) was amazing, they lost 2-1 like but they were singing, banging drums and generally going mad. The opposition side San Lorenzos keeper scored a penalty and went mad taunting the home fans ; so they threw bottles of piss at him and spat...tres funny....the away fans got their own back by urinating on the home fans...madness. We sat in the "quieter" section but it was an amazing experience. Other than that we took a tango lesson and saw a show which was great, the dancers are tres skilled.
